Basic Overview of Needle Roller Bearings

Needle roller bearings derive their name from their slender cylindrical rolling elements. These bearings frequently apply in designs requiring a compact profile and substantial load-carrying capacity. Also, they are advantageous in scenarios where limited space and high load capacity are critical factors, ruling out the use of heavy spherical or ball bearings. The efficiency of needle roller bearings lies in their ability to accommodate significant loads relative to their compact size, achieved through linear contact that evenly distributes the load along the length of the rollers.

The versatility of needle roller bearings is underscored by their various design configurations, allowing them to cater to various applications. Each unique design serves a distinct purpose, enabling these bearings to excel in diverse scenarios and contribute to creating smaller, lighter designs where speed or friction considerations make traditional bushings impractical.

An Anatomy of Needle Roller Bearings

While needle roller bearings may seem straightforward initially, their seemingly simple appearance contradicts a carefully engineered design crafted to meet specific goals. These bearings feature cylindrical rollers much longer than their diameter, resembling tiny needles. The streamlined shape of these rollers facilitates a compact design and provides a capacity for handling substantial loads and effectively transmitting radial loads.

Typically comprising an outer ring, an inner ring, and the needle rollers, needle roller bearings showcase precision in their manufacturing to ensure a snug fit between the rollers and the raceways. Their unique construction minimizes friction, boosting overall performance. The adaptability of needle roller bearings is apparent in their capability to accommodate both radial and axial loads, rendering them indispensable in various applications.

High Load Carrying Capacity

Drawn cup needle roller bearings are designed to support heavy loads in a small space. These rollers have a unique cylindrical shape that provides a larger contact area with the raceways and spreads the load evenly. It is especially useful in compact spaces, like cars, where these bearings are widely used in gearboxes, transmissions, wheel hubs, appliances, and power tools.

These bearings can handle significant radial loads, making them suitable for tough machinery. Their ability to carry heavy loads demonstrates the careful engineering of these simple components, ensuring stable and reliable performance even in challenging conditions.

Reduced Friction for Efficiency

Optimizing efficiency is a central goal in mechanical engineering components, and heavy-duty needle roller bearings are pivotal in minimizing friction. The slim design of the rollers decreases the contact surface with the raceways, leading to diminished frictional forces. This process boosts the machinery's overall efficiency and results in energy conservation.

The diminished friction not only aids in efficiency but also contributes to lower heat production, which is a vital consideration in various applications where temperature regulation is important. The efficiency improvements derived from the adoption of needle roller bearings positively impact the performance and lifespan of the supported machinery.

Precision Positioning and Accuracy

Precision is paramount in numerous engineering applications, and heavy-duty needle roller bearings are unique for delivering exact and controlled movement. The cylindrical rollers and seamless manufacturing tolerances enable the precise positioning of bearing components. This precision of bearing bushing becomes particularly advantageous in applications where seamless alignment is important, such as machine tools and robotics.

The capability of needle roller bearings to uphold accurate alignment even under diverse loads and speeds significantly elevates machinery's overall performance and dependability. This primary objective proves crucial in industries where precision is non-negotiable, ensuring that components seamlessly collaborate to achieve the intended results. Heavy Duty Needle Rollers

Heavy-duty needle rollers are an excellent choice in situations demanding robust handling of substantial static, dynamic, or shock loads. These machined or Heavy Duty Type needle rollers possess a compact design, solid machined outer ring, and comparatively low sectional height. The outer ring's solidity enhances overall sturdiness and enables the bearing to manage more significant loads than drawn cup needle bearings.

These heavy-duty needle rollers find practical application in various scenarios, such as gear pumps, sheaves, automotive transmissions, and two-cycle engines. Their ability to withstand and navigate heavy loads makes them reliable components in these settings, contributing to the efficiency and durability of the machinery they are employed in.

Versatility In Applications

Needle roller bearings showcase impressive adaptability, rendering them suitable for various uses. These bearings are valuable across diverse industries, whether in automotive transmissions or textile machinery, from aircraft engines to medical equipment. Their capacity to handle radial and axial loads, coupled with their compact design, positions needle roller bearings as the preferred selection of engineers seeking dependable and effective solutions.

In the automotive domain, needle roller bearings ensure smooth operations within gearboxes, differentials, and constant velocity joints. In aerospace applications, where weight and space limitations are crucial, these bearings contribute significantly to the overall efficiency of aircraft systems. The flexibility of needle roller bearings underscores their ability to meet the evolving requirements of modern engineering practices.

Durability and Longevity

Engineering components need not only to function effectively but also endure over time. These Needle roller bearings are designed to enhance durability and can withstand substantial loads, high speeds, and demanding operating conditions. The materials employed in their construction, combined with advanced heat treatment techniques, enhance the overall resilience of these bearings.

Ensuring the prolonged lifespan of needle roller bearings is a vital goal, particularly in industries where operational interruptions can be expensive and inconvenient. These dependability and extended service life position these bearings as a favored choice for applications where performance and durability are indispensable requirements.
